KAPPC Chairman's Statement

Date: 27/10/2019 | Source: Naenara (En) | Read original version at source

Kim Yong Chol, chairman of the Korea Asia-Pacific Peace Committee, (KAPPC) made public a statement on October 27.

The statement reads:

Of late, the US is resorting to the hostile policy towards the DPRK more desperately, misjudging the patience and tolerance of the DPRK.

Finding fault with the DPRK on its measure for bolstering up its military capability for self-defence at the recent meeting of the First Committee of the 74th United Nations General Assembly, the US delegate said the US would not enter the US-DPRK dialogue with its eyes close and north Korea must come up with a new methodology for FFVD, which got on the nerves of the DPRK.

Meanwhile, the US is persistently pressurizing other countries into implementing the UN "sanctions resolutions" and is leaving no stone unturned to get the anti-DPRK resolutions passed in the UN General Assembly, using its satellite countries.

The US strategic forces commander nominee, speaking at the Senate, called the DPRK "a rogue state" out of an evil intent, and the warlike forces of the US military are reportedly planning nuclear strike exercises against the DPRK.

The situation points to the US intent to isolate and stifle the DPRK in a more crafty and vicious way than before, instead of complying with our call for a change in its calculation method.

The DPRK-US relations, which could have been derailed and fallen apart several times due to such hostile acts and wrong habitual practices on the part of the US, are still maintained. It goes to the credit of the close personal relations between Chairman Kim Jong Un of the State Affairs Commission and President Trump.

But there is a limit to everything.

The close personal relations between the top leaders of the two countries can never be kept aloof from the public mindset, and they are never a guarantee for preventing the DPRK-US relations from getting aggravated or for making up for.

The US trumpets the crucial measures taken by the DPRK for confidence-building as its own "diplomatic gains", but no substantial progress has been made in the DPRK-US relations and the belligerent relations still persists that there can be the exchange of fire any moment.

The US is seriously mistaken if it has an idea of passing off in peace the end of this year, by exploiting the close personal relations between its President and the Chairman of the State Affairs Commission of the DPRK for a delaying tactics.

My hope is that the diplomatic adage that there is neither a permanent foe nor a permanent friend does not change into the one that there is a permanent foe but no a permanent friend.
